Ball Ground's north Cherokee clay is both a blessing and a curse. It holds moisture, which sounds good until you realize traditional sod drowns in it or, conversely, develops hard pan that prevents drainage. Artificial turf actually thrives here because we engineer proper base preparation and sub-surface drainage to work *with* that clay, not against it. The area's elevation and exposure mean you'll get strong afternoon sun on most commercial properties—especially anything in the Downtown Ball Ground vicinity—which is perfect for synthetic turf. There's no scorch risk, no dormancy problems, and no fading like you'd see with natural grass in direct heat. Shade patterns around older commercial buildings near the Etowah River access areas can be tricky, but artificial turf handles dappled or partial shade better than most people expect. Installation in Ball Ground typically runs smoothly because the clay base, while dense, is stable and predictable. We don't encounter the sandy soil issues that plague southern Georgia, and we're not fighting red clay erosion like you see further into the mountains. Lot sizes in the commercial zones are usually manageable—this isn't sprawling commercial real estate—which means faster installation and lower material costs compared to larger suburban projects.
Yes, and that's actually where artificial turf shines in this area. We install a perforated base layer above the clay, add crushed stone and drainage fabric, then the turf itself. Water moves through the synthetic fibers and into the stone base, then percolates through the clay gradually. You won't see puddling or waterlogging like you sometimes get with natural sod sitting on dense clay. The system is designed for exactly this soil profile.
